The Village Trust

About us: 

The Brookfield Village Trust was set up to acquire the Merchiston Field, which lies between the Victoria Road houses and the former Merchiston Hospital and thereby preserves our Village envelope.

Since last year’s AGM, the Merchiston site, with the exception of the Merchiston Field, has been sold by Greater Glasgow Health Board (GGHB) to David Wilson Homes and planning permission has been granted for erection of 267 houses on the site.

GGHB want to dispose of the Merchiston Field and this year’s AGM provides an opportunity for the Board to report on the discussions that have taken place with GGHB for the purchase of the Merchiston Field by the Trust.
